Remote (California-based preferred, minimal travel to San Jose, CA) $170K$230K DOE + Immediate Benefits About the Role We are seeking a plug-and-play Senior Program Manager to lead the delivery of critical drinking-water well projects for one of Californias largest water utilities. This role requires a proven track record managing California-specific permitting and regulatory approvals (CEQA, DDW, CUP, RWQCB, county well ordinances), as well as hands-on leadership of multi-million-dollar capital delivery programs. This is not a learning opportunity we need someone who can step in on day one and own permitting conversations with agencies, anticipate challenges, and keep complex well development projects on track. Key Responsibilities • Lead program delivery of new potable water well development, rehabilitation of existing wells, and treatment facility tie-ins. • Manage all aspects of California permitting: • CEQA (IS/MNDs, EIRs) • State Water Board Division of Drinking Water (DDW) approvals • County Well Ordinances and Conditional Use Permits (CUPs) • Regional Water Quality Control Board (RWQCB) discharge permits • Serve as the permitting authority within the project team able to answer agency questions and guide consultants and contractors through the approval process. • Drive program controls, including scheduling, budgeting, risk management, and reporting. • Develop and maintain project dashboards and performance metrics in MS Project and Power BI. • Coordinate cross-functional teams, contractors, and subconsultants to ensure timely and compliant delivery. • Provide executive-level updates, status reports, and recommendations to utility leadership. Required Qualifications • 10+ years of program/project management experience in California utility capital delivery. • Minimum 5 years managing drinking-water well projects (new, rehab, or treatment-related). • Direct, proven experience with California permitting, including CEQA, DDW approvals, CUPs, county well ordinances, and RWQCB discharge permits. • Strong stakeholder management, contractor oversight, and team leadership skills. • Proficiency in MS Project and Power BI. • Excellent communication and executive reporting ability. Preferred Qualifications • California Professional Engineer (PE) license. • PMP or PgMP certification. • Experience with PFAS-impacted wells or advanced treatment projects. • Prior leadership at a California water utility, municipal water agency, or consulting firm delivering water well permitting projects.
